Fatty acids are normally oxidized in the mitochondria of the cell. Through a series of enzymatic reactions, fatty acids are broken down to produce energy in the form of ATP.
Lipids are important to the composition of the plasma membrane because they are what keeps the water inside the cell separated from the water outside. This is due to the lipid bilayer's amphiphilic nature.
Cholesterol itself is not a fatty acid; it is a type of sterol, which is a complex lipid. However, cholesterol is often found in association with fatty acids in the body, particularly in cell membranes and lipoproteins. While both cholesterol and fatty acids are important components of lipids, they have distinct chemical structures and functions.
Lipids are the group of organic compounds that contain fatty acids. Lipids include fats, oils, phospholipids, and steroids, and they play important roles in energy storage, cell structure, and signaling in living organisms.

Nucleic acids cannot be formed by fatty acids. Nucleic acids, such as DNA and RNA, are composed of nucleotides, whereas fatty acids are molecules that primarily serve as a source of energy and as building blocks for cell membranes.
